サイバーセキュリティニュース

Apple、iMessageを量子コンピュータ攻撃から守る新プロトコル「PQ3」導入

AppleがiMessageのセキュリティを強化、量子コンピュータ攻撃に対抗する新プロトコル「PQ3」を導入。iOS、iPadOS、macOS、watchOSの最新ベータ版で利用可能。量子耐性アルゴリズムを使用し、最高レベルのセキュリティを提供。【用語解説とAIによる専門的コメントつき】

Published

on

Appleは、iMessageの暗号化プロトコルを量子コンピュータによる攻撃から保護するために、PQ3と呼ばれる新しいプロトコルを導入しました。このプロトコルは、将来量子コンピューティングが従来の暗号化方法を破る可能性がある状況において、ユーザーのチャットを保護することを目的としています。PQ3は、iOS 17.4、iPadOS 17.4、macOS 14.4、watchOS 10.4の開発者プレビューやベータ版で利用可能であり、年末までに既存のエンドツーエンドのメッセージングプロトコルと完全に置き換える予定です。

量子耐性のあるアルゴリズムを使用することで、量子コンピュータによる攻撃から暗号鍵を保護する取り組みが進んでいます。PQ3は、初期キーの確立とセッションの再鍵交換の両方でポスト量子暗号を使用し、セキュリティレベル3に位置付けられています。Appleは、このプロトコルのセキュリティを内部のセキュリティエンジニアリングおよびアーキテクチャ(SEAR)チームと外部の暗号学の専門家によって検証しています。

iMessageのセキュリティレベルは、Level 0からLevel 3まで存在し、PQ3は最高レベルのセキュリティを提供します。このプロトコルでは、Elliptic Curve暗号(ECC)とKyberポスト量子公開鍵が使用されています。iMessageは複数のデバイスを同じアカウントに登録でき、各デバイスは独自の暗号化キーを生成します。

【ニュース解説】

AppleがiMessageの暗号化プロトコルをアップグレードし、将来的に量子コンピュータによって従来の暗号が破られる可能性がある状況に備え、ユーザーのチャットを保護するための新しいプロトコル「PQ3」を導入しました。このプロトコルは、量子コンピューティングの進展によって今日の暗号化技術が脅かされる未来を見据え、エンドツーエンドのメッセージングセキュリティを強化することを目的としています。PQ3は、iOS 17.4、iPadOS 17.4、macOS 14.4、watchOS 10.4の開発者プレビューおよびベータ版で利用可能となり、年内には既存のメッセージングプロトコルに完全に置き換わる予定です。

量子コンピュータは、従来のコンピュータとは異なる原理で動作し、特定の種類の計算を非常に高速に実行できる可能性があります。これにより、現在安全とされている多くの暗号化技術が破られるリスクが生じます。AppleがPQ3を導入することで、量子コンピュータによる将来的な脅威からユーザーのプライバシーを守ることを目指しています。

PQ3プロトコルは、セキュリティレベル3に分類され、これはAppleによると、現在広く展開されている他のメッセージングアプリよりも高い保護を提供するとされています。このプロトコルでは、Elliptic Curve暗号(ECC)に加えて、キーの確立とセッションの再鍵交換の両方でKyberポスト量子公開鍵を使用しています。これにより、量子コンピュータによる将来の攻撃からも安全な通信が可能になります。

この技術の導入は、個人のプライバシー保護において重要な一歩ですが、同時にいくつかの潜在的な課題も伴います。例えば、新しい暗号化技術の実装には、既存のシステムとの互換性の問題や、新しいセキュリティ脆弱性の可能性があります。また、量子コンピュータの実現可能性やその進展速度に関する不確実性も残ります。さらに、このような高度なセキュリティ技術の普及には、法規制や国際的な協力が必要になる場合があります。

長期的には、量子コンピューティングの発展に伴い、PQ3のようなポスト量子暗号化技術が広く採用されることで、デジタル通信の安全性が大幅に向上する可能性があります。これにより、個人情報の保護だけでなく、国家安全保障や経済活動におけるセキュリティの強化にも寄与することが期待されます。しかし、この技術の普及と効果的な実装には、技術的な課題の克服や、関連する法規制の整備など、さまざまな取り組みが必要となるでしょう。

from Apple promises to protect iMessage chats from quantum computers.

Trending

モバイルバージョンを終了